python一般用来做什么?
感谢您的邀请:作为一种非常流行的语言,python有着广泛的应用场景。事实上,许多开发语言可以用于不同的领域。python不是为特定目的而产生的。但是,它是一种通用的脚本语言,也称为glue语言。glue意味着python可以在c语言接口的帮助下驱动几乎所有已知的软件和模块。只要我们使用它,你通常可以找到一个开源库。安装后,您可以驱动它。无论是数据库、网络、互联网、图形、游戏、科学计算、gui、oa、自动控制,甚至宇航员都在使用它。
现在我们来谈谈python,它可以用来做:
1。系统编程2。图形处理3。数学处理4。文本处理5。数据库编程6。网络编程7。网络编程8。多媒体应用9。pymo发动机10。黑客编程11。用python12编写的简单爬虫:人工智能
看到这么多应用场景非常强大,但python通常不会作为工程语言出现。也就是说,常规软件生产不使用它。主要使用java,c#,xml,c。至于为什么,这是软件工程的需要。python没有完整的语法检查。
但它现在不影响python的状态。很多人加入python的大军是因为python很容易入门,而且学习成本相对较低。它有一个丰富的支持库,可以直接调用,以高效地完成不同需要的工作。
你知道,谷歌最早的搜索引擎是由python编写的。
希望我的回答能对你有所帮助。我是bangbang,软件开发。
如何用python计算方差,平均值?
python来计算均值和方差,用python来计算均值和方差,你可以写,你也可以用numpy,但是哪个更快?我做了个实验。首先,我生成了900万个样本:nlist=range(09000000)nlist=[float(i)/1000000forinnlist]n=len(nlist)。第二行是把样本缩小,否则会从100万溢出到900万。自我实现,遍历数组以查找平均方差:sum1=0.0sum2=0.0foriiinrange(n):sum1=nlist[i]sum2=nlist[i]**2mean=sum1/nvar=sum2/n-mean**2需要5.3s,借助numpy向量运算来查找:importnumpyarray=numpy.数组(nlist)sum1=narray.sum公司()narray2=narray*narraysum2=narray2。sum()mean=sum1/nvar=sum2/n-mean**2取1.0s
deffangcha():a=float(原始输入(“请输入a:”)b=float(请输入b:”)输入(“请输入b:”)c=float(请输入c:”)d=(a,b,c)/3.0e=((a-d)**2(b-d)**2(c-d)**2)/3.0print“平均值为:f,方差为:f”%(d,e)fangcha()可用的python2.7
方差是概率论和统计方差测量随机变量或一组数据时离散度的度量。在概率论中,方差用来衡量随机变量与其数学期望(即均值)之间的偏差。统计学中的方差(样本方差)是每个样本值与所有样本值的平均值之差的平方的平均值。在许多实际问题中,研究方差即偏离度具有重要意义。方差是源数据和期望值之间差异的度量。当数据分布相对分散时(即数据在平均值附近波动较大),各数据与平均值之差的平方和较大,方差较大;当数据分布相对集中时,各数据与平均值之差的平方和较小。因此,方差越大,数据波动越大;方差越小,数据波动越小。平均数是一组数据中的趋势数,是一组数据中所有数据的总和除以该组数据中的数据数。它是数据集趋势的指标。解决平均问题的关键是确定“总数量”和总数量对应的总份数。它不仅可以反映一组数据的总体情况和平均水平,还可以比较不同组的数据,看出组间的差异。用平均数来表示一组数据具有直观、简洁的特点,因此在日常生活中经常使用,如平均速度、平均身高、平均产量、平均得分等。
原文标题:python编写计算方差的函数 python一般用来做什么?,如若转载,请注明出处:https://www.saibowen.com/wenda/18275.html
免责声明:此资讯系转载自合作媒体或互联网其它网站,「赛伯温」登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,文章内容仅供参考。